Day 141:

This fall outfit is all about the layers. It features

a white tank top tucked into my high waisted

American Eagle skinny jeans over which I wore

my olive green sweater cardigan and knee high

black boots. My accessories included a black

choker necklace and my gold crystal necklace.

Day 143:

I love the look of fishnet tights, but I have always

been too afraid to wear them because of the

"sexiness" that tends to accompany them. However,

this challenge has pushed me into being more open

to trying out new things and I decided to go for it. I

paired the tights with my faux suede skirt from Old

Navy, my black long sleeve from

Maurices, and my black Old Navy booties.

Day 145:

I absolutely love the look of vests with my outfits

because they are a cute and easy way to add a little

bit of color and dimension to any outfit.

(I have this exact same Old Navy vest in 5 different colors!)

I paired my vest with my gray Mossimo long sleeve,

my American Eagle skinny jeans, and my cognac

booties. For accessories I wore my cognac

belt and gold prism necklace.
